Does canvas quiz track your activity?

The Canvas quiz log does not track student activity in other programs or other activity in a browser. There is a status noted in the quiz log called: “Stopped viewing the Canvas quiz-taking page”. Page view logs can be used to determine if a user accessed other Canvas content while taking a Canvas quiz.

What does stopped viewing the canvas quiz taking page mean?

Stopped viewing the Canvas quiz-taking page [3]: the student navigates away from the quiz (closes the browser tab, opens a new browser tab, or navigates to a different program) for more than 15 seconds, or the student is inactive within Canvas for more than 30 seconds (including navigating to another Canvas page).

Can teachers see failed submissions on canvas?

TEACHER VIEWS Instructors can view the status of a student’s assignment submission in the Canvas Gradebook. The score column displays a submission icon for successful uploads, an Upload Failed icon for failed uploads, and an Uploading icon for queued submissions.

What does score t mean on canvas?

T Icon: Text entry submitted, not graded. Link Icon: Website URL submitted, not graded. Blank Cell: Assignment not submitted, not graded.
